THE GREAT HALL is a monthly evening pub gathering of diverse individuals. The organizers of this event have three major overlapping interests:
THE ÚLFRHEIM FAMILY MOTORCYCLE CLUB (FMC)
This is the Great Hall's anchor group. We are comprised of brothers and sisters of diverse races, backgrounds, and faiths. We ride cruisers, sportbikes, and baggers of all makes and models. Our name comes from the Old Norse “úlfr” meaning “wolf,” and “heim” meaning “hall, or home,” we are Úlfrheim: the Hall of the Spirit Wolf. We strive to serve our community at large, with a special focus on bringing awareness to the PTSD that affects so many of our military veterans and their families.
THE ASATRU KINDRED
While Úlfrheim’s members come from many faiths, or no faith at all, the majority of us are aligned with Ásatrú, which is a reconstruction of the old Norse-based religion of Scandinavia. We embrace personal responsibility, courage, and loyalty, and look to the gods to guide us on the path of reaching our highest potential. We do not petition them for favors, but we thank them for what we have, and request the strength to face life’s challenges.
THE GUILD of NORTHUMBRIA
Throughout the year the Guild gathers to plan, play, create costumes, and practice recreations of medieval fighting. In the Fall The Guild hosts one of the major camps of the yearly Las Vegas Renaissance Fair: The Empire of Northumbria— a truly unforgettable experience!
At THE GREAT HALL we enjoy each others' company and enjoy meeting new people who share any of our interests. As this is a pub gathering we can only invite adults, but many of our activities throughout the year are definitely family friendly.
